There is no direct connection from Positano to Melbourne. However, you can take the ferry to Naples Beverello, walk to Napoli - Piazza Bovio, take the bus to Napoli - Capodichino Aeroporto, walk to Naples Airport (NAP) airport, fly to Melbourne Airport (MEL), walk to Melbourne Airport T1 Skybus/Arrival Dr, then take the bus to Skybus Coach Terminal. Alternatively, you can take the ferry to Naples Beverello, walk to Municipio, take the subway to Piazza Garibaldi, walk to Napoli, take the train to Roma Termini, take the line 4570 train to Fiumicino Aeroporto, walk to Fiumicino International Airport (FCO) airport, fly to Melbourne Airport (MEL), walk to Melbourne Airport T1 Skybus/Arrival Dr, then take the bus to Skybus Coach Terminal.
